Quantity Surveying Technical Apprenticeship 2026 – East Berkshire
Join us for a full‑time earn‑and‑learn position with BAM, one of Europe’s largest construction companies. The five‑year apprenticeship will deliver hands‑on experience on multi‑million‑pound projects and will take you from Level 4 Higher Apprenticeship to a Level 6 Degree Apprenticeship. You will be based in East Berkshire and work across a range of sectors, including sustainable infrastructure, commercial buildings and complex civil works.
ProgrammeStructure
- Years 1–2 – Level 4 Higher Apprenticeship in Quantity Surveying, culminating in a Higher National Certificate (HNC) and progress towards professional recognition with the Chartered Institute of Building (CIOB).
- Years 3–5 – Level 6 Degree Apprenticeship, delivering a full honours degree and further development towards CIOB chartered membership.
- Technical Development – Gain hands‑on experience and apply learning on site.
- Problem Solving – Overcome challenges on live projects, drive quality through effective planning and right‑first‑time delivery.
- On‑Site Experience – Work closely with our skilled workforce, apply and manage contracts, monitor costs, and record changes with senior quantity surveyors.
- Safety & Sustainability – Ensure safe work in line with company health and safety policies, maintain high environmental awareness, and monitor delivery against programme and construction methods.
Academic Requirements:
- GCSE grade 5 (B) or above in Maths
- GCSE grade 4 (C) or above in English Language
- 3 additional GCSEs, grade 4 or above
- 2 × STEM A‑Levels or finance, economics, business or relevant Level 3 qualifications (e.g., Civil Engineering, Construction in Built Environment – Quantity Surveying)
- T Level Design, Planning & Surveying for Construction (or an equivalent)
